Jordanian, Egyptian physicians arrive to treat ailing Arafat (Oct 09 2003 14:56 GMT) - Jordanian, Egyptian physicians arrive to treat ailing Arafat A joint team of Jordanian and Egyptian physicians arrived in Ramallah Wednesday evening to treat Palestinian Authority Chairman Yasser Arafat for a mysterious virus amid reports that his health was rapidly deteriorating. Arafat blames Israeli media of publishing false information about his health condition Dr. Ashraf Kurdi, Yasser Arafats Jordanian doctor, on Thursday told Al Bawaba that the PA leader is denying any deterioration in his health and the alleged mild heart-attack he was struck with, and instead has attacked the Israeli press for their accusations saying the Israeli press is who infected me with the disease (accusing them of fabricating the story). |
